If your father have a new mac you need to open up Finder- Menu- Go (before Windows) and scroll down to The House/Home Put your mouse pointer over The House and press Alt - and there you find the library.
Select the Gimpfile and you supose to find everything in there.

Must be a misunderstanding, i know where is the gimp user folder (that you call library) on MAC , that anyway don't contain the gimp program's files but is a empty storage place where the user (i.e you) may add extra add on

What you was looking for instead was another , different gimp folder that should be in "Applications" and that contain the real program...
